Players from the EEU countries will not be considered as legionaries in Russia

the Ministry of sports of Russia to the rescue of domestic football. The main governing body of the country has prepared a decree according to which the players from the countries of the Eurasian economic Union will not be considered as legionaries in the competitions held on the territory of Russia.

it is Worth Recalling that in the EAEC includes Russia, Armenia, Belarus, Kazakhstan and Kyrgyzstan. The order was signed by the former Minister of sport Pavel Kolobkov, who yesterday resigned in the government. However, the document is published on the Internet portal of legal information.

In the football championship of Russia has a limit on foreign players in the format of “6+5” – no more than six foreigners on the field at the same team. However, as already reported Вести.Ru starting from the season 2020-2021 limit will change its format – “8+17”, in which the application of the club for the season can be no more than eight foreign players.
